How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sunrise Vista Chino?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Sunrise Vista Chino Studio Apartments | $1,604 | $1,345 | $2,393 |
| Sunrise Vista Chino 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,788 | $1,495 | $2,350 |
| Sunrise Vista Chino 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,194 | $1,800 | $4,374 |
| Sunrise Vista Chino 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,558 | $2,395 | $2,725 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Sunrise Vista Chino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Sunrise Vista Chino with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Sunrise Vista Chino is at Latitude 33 listed at $1,399.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Sunrise Vista Chino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Sunrise Vista Chino is $1,604.
What is the largest available Studio Sunrise Vista Chino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Sunrise Vista Chino is a 500 square feet unit starting from $1,550 at The Modern Cactus.
